Soundboard integrity (cracks, separation, crown loss), bridge condition and gluing, pin block integrity, cast iron frame, cabinet structure and case condition.
All strings checked for corrosion, rust, breakage and uneven winding. Tuning pins tested for holding power — a failed pin block is one of the most expensive structural repairs.
Key travel, centre pin corrosion, spring condition, wippen function, damper alignment and response across the full keyboard. Note any stiff, silent or misbehaving keys.
Hammer felt condition — groove depth, compression, alignment. Assess whether voicing or replacement is required and note any uneven tone across the registers.
Check all 88 key tops for chips, cracks, missing pieces and yellowing. Assess key level (evenness of all keys at rest) and note any warped or missing keys.
All pedal functions tested. Cabinet inspected for damage, veneer peeling, hinge condition and lid/fallboard operation. Note cosmetic defects that affect value.
Buying a second-hand piano in Singapore without an independent inspection is a significant risk. Common issues found in second-hand pianos include: tuning pins that no longer hold tension (requires pin block replacement at S$1,500–S$3,000), broken bass strings, severely worn hammer felt, stuck or non-returning keys, and moisture damage to the soundboard. These faults are not visible from a casual look at the piano and are rarely disclosed by private sellers.
An inspection fee of S$80–S$150 can save you from a purchase that requires thousands in repairs, or help you negotiate a fair price that reflects the piano's actual condition.
